Topic:Anesthesia

Anesthesia in horses involves the administration of drugs to induce a temporary loss of sensation or consciousness, facilitating surgical procedures and other medical interventions. This complex process requires a deep understanding of equine physiology and pharmacology to ensure the safety and well-being of the animal. Anesthesia in horses can be challenging due to their size, temperament, and unique anatomical and physiological characteristics. Common anesthetic agents used in equine practice include inhalants like isoflurane and sevoflurane, as well as injectable drugs such as ketamine and xylazine. The management of anesthesia in horses also involves careful monitoring of vital signs and the use of supportive measures to prevent complications such as hypotension, hypoventilation, and post-anesthetic myopathy. Clinical experiences with isoflurane in dogs and horses.
The Veterinary record    July 5, 1986   Volume 119, Issue 1 8-10 doi: 10.1136/vr.119.1.8
Jones RS, Seymour CJ.The inhalational anaesthetic agent isoflurane was administered to 22 dogs and 21 horses undergoing a variety of surgical procedures. Satisfactory anaesthesia was produced in all the animals. The cardiopulmonary changes were similar to those observed with halothane. Rapid changes in the depth of anaesthesia were achieved and recovery from anaesthesia was rapid in both dogs and horses, which was a reflection of the relative insolubility of isoflurane. Iopamidol myelography in the horse.
Equine veterinary journal    May 1, 1986   Volume 18, Issue 3 199-202 doi: 10.1111/j.2042-3306.1986.tb03597.x
May SA, Wyn-Jones G, Church S, Brouwer GJ, Jones RS.The use of the non-ionic, water-soluble contrast agent iopamidol for myelography in seven horses is described. Contrast columns of diagnostic quality were produced in all seven cases and the procedure did not invoke any adverse reactions in the five cases which were recovered from general anaesthesia. It is concluded that iopamidol is a safe and effective contrast agent for myelography in the horse.

Pulmonary function in the horse during anaesthesia: a review.
Journal of the South African Veterinary Association    March 1, 1986   Volume 57, Issue 1 49-53 
Stegmann GF.The effect of abnormal body position on cardiovascular and pulmonary function in the awake and anaesthetised horse is reviewed. Parameters such as pulmonary shunt, lung volumes, blood gases and alveolar-arterial oxygen partial pressure differences are discussed. Withholding food for 24 hours and mechanical ventilation may be used to improve blood gas values associated with abnormal recumbency during anaesthesia. During prolonged recovery, horses should be encouraged to adopt sternal recumbency.
